Icewine is Niagara's signature sweet dessert wine, made from grapes frozen on the vine. The region's climate and vineyards make it a defining local specialty.
Peameal bacon on a bun is a Southern Ontario classic of cured pork loin rolled in cornmeal, often served simply in a soft bun with mustard.
Butter tarts are a classic Ontario dessert with a flaky shell and gooey butter-sugar filling. They are a beloved bakery staple across the region.

Moderate for Canada. Hotels near the falls are pricey, but dining and local transit are in line with major Ontario tourist areas.
Tip 15-20% at restaurants before tax. Round up or tip 10% for taxis. Small change or 10% is common at cafes.
